Fundamentos de desenvolvimento de ROS: nós, tópicos e a estrutura de robótica padrão
Construa uma compreensão clara e fácil de usar do Sistema Operacional de Robôs, seus principais conceitos e por que ele se tornou a estrutura padrão em robótica.
Sobre este curso
O Sistema Operacional de Robôs, ROS, tornou-se a estrutura de software padrão que conecta equipes de robótica em todo o mundo.Mesmo as equipes que não executam o ROS na produção geralmente compartilham seu vocabulário e padrões de design.Este curso oferece uma introdução calma e estruturada para que você possa ler o código ROS, seguir a documentação do projeto e começar a contribuir sem se sentir perdido.
Você aprenderá o que o ROS realmente fornece, como seus conceitos centrais se encaixam e como o ROS 2 moderno mudou a estrutura para o uso da produção.O curso permanece fundamentado em padrões amplamente utilizados e respeita as realidades de projetos reais de robótica.
O que você vai aprender:
- Entenda o que o ROS fornece e por que ele se tornou a estrutura padrão de robótica
- Reconhecer os principais conceitos de ROS, incluindo nós, tópicos, serviços e parâmetros
- Explore o papel dos tipos de mensagem, layout de pacote e o sistema de construção em projetos reais
- Leia como o ROS suporta simulação através do Gazebo e visualização através do RViz
- Identificar as principais diferenças entre ROS 1 e ROS 2 e o que elas significam para novos projetos
- Entenda os pontos de integração entre o ROS e os fluxos de trabalho de robótica mais amplos, incluindo CI e testes
O curso começa com o papel do ROS na robótica moderna, passa pelos conceitos básicos e organização do projeto, e fecha com as diferenças entre o ROS 1 e o ROS 2 e as realidades do trabalho de produção.Exercícios escritos ajudam você a mapear cada conceito para um cenário real de robótica.
Este curso é projetado para iniciantes absolutos com alguma experiência geral de programação, incluindo estudantes de ciência da computação, desenvolvedores de software que entram em robótica e engenheiros explorando sistemas autônomos.Não é necessária experiência prévia em ROS.O curso explica cada conceito à medida que aparece e permanece focado na compreensão, em vez de tutoriais linha a linha.
O que você vai receber
-
📜
Certificado de conclusão
Adicione ao seu perfil do LinkedIn -
🎧
Versão em áudio incluída
Estude em qualquer lugar, sem tela -
♾️
Acesso vitalício
Volte quando quiser, sem expirar -
📱
Celular ou computador
Funciona em qualquer dispositivo -
💸
Reembolso em 30 dias
Sem perguntas -
⚡
Curto e focado
32 min de conteúdo prático
Avaliações
Ainda não há avaliações — seja o primeiro a compartilhar sua experiência.
Outros também fizeram
Construa uma base em engenharia de software UAV aprendendo a programar controladores de voo, gerenciar dados de sensores e automatizar missões aéreas.
R$ 24,90
Aprenda a desenvolver software de robótica escalável a partir do zero usando Python e C ++ sem precisar de qualquer experiência anterior no sistema operacional do robô.
R$ 24,90
Aprenda os fundamentos da robótica, eletrônica e codificação, entendendo como montar e programar um robô OTTO DIY de código aberto.
R$ 24,90
Construa um entendimento claro e amigável para iniciantes de Localização e Mapeamento Simultâneos, como robôs constroem mapas enquanto rastreiam sua própria localização.
R$ 24,90
Perguntas frequentes
O que preciso para fazer este curso? +
Só um celular ou computador com internet. Sem instalações nem hardware especial.
Como faço para pagar? +
Com cartão via Stripe. Não guardamos dados do cartão — o Stripe processa com segurança.
Posso pedir reembolso? +
Sim — reembolso integral em 30 dias, sem perguntas.
Por quanto tempo terei acesso? +
Para sempre. Uma vez comprado, o curso é seu para revisar quando quiser.
Vou receber um certificado? +
Sim. Ao concluir, você recebe um certificado que pode adicionar ao seu perfil do LinkedIn.
Feito para profissionais em
Tecnologia
Design
Finanças
Marketing
Saúde
Educação
Hotelaria
Indústria